Prep Time 8 hours
Cook Time 1 hour
Total Time 9 hours
Course Salad
Cuisine Mediterranean
Servings 4 servings
Calories

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up dried chickpeas
  • 4 cups water
  • 1 tsp salt, divided
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 1 cucumber, diced
  • 1 red bell pepper, diced
  • 1/4 red onion, th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up Kalamata olives, pitted and halved
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1/4 cup fresh mint, chopped

For the dressing:

  • 3 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il
  • 2 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• 1/2 tsp Dijon mustard
  • salt and pepper to taste

Instructions
 

  • Rinse the dried chickpeas thoroughly under cold water. Place them in a large bowl and cover with water. Let them soak overnight or for at least 8 hours. Drain and rinse again.
  • Transfer the soaked chickpeas to a large pot and add 4 cups of water and 1/2 teaspoon of salt.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at and simmer for about 1 hour or until the chickpeas are tender. Skim off any foam that forms on the surface during cooking. Drain and set aside.
  • In a large salad bowl, combine the cooked chickpeas, cherry tomatoes, cucumber, red bell pepper, red onion, Kalamata olives, parsley, and mint.
  • In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, Dijon mustard, and remaining 1/2 teaspoon of salt. Season with additional salt and pepper to taste.
  • Drizzle the dressing over the chickpea salad and toss gently to combine, ensuring all the ingredients are evenly coated.
  • Allow the salad to sit for about 15 minutes to let the flavors meld together. You can serve it immediately or refrigerate for a few hours to let the flavors intensify.
  • Just before serving, give the salad a quick toss to redistribute the dressing. Garnish with additional fresh herbs if desired.

Notes

Cooking Tips:
  1. Soaking the dried chickpeas overnight helps to soften them and reduce cooking time. If you’re short on time, you can use canned chickpeas, but the texture may differ slightly.
  2. To ensure even cooking, make sure the chickpeas are fully submerged in water during the cooking process. Add more water if needed.
  3. Be sure to skim off any foam that forms on the surface while cooking the chickpeas. This helps to remove impurities and ensures a cleaner flavor.
  4. For added flavor and a slight tang, consider adding a splash of apple cider vinegar to the cooking water when simmering the chickpeas.
  5. To enhance the salad’s texture, blanch the diced red bell pepper in boiling water for a minute, then rinse with cold water before adding it to the salad.
  6. Don’t be afraid to customize the salad by adding other vegetables or herbs of your choice. It’s a great way to incorporate seasonal produce and experiment with flavors.
  7. If making the salad ahead of time, keep the dressing separate until serving. This helps to prevent the salad from becoming soggy.

FAQs about Cooking Dried Chickpeas

How long do I need to soak dried chickpeas before cooking them?

It is recommended to soak dried chickpeas for at least 8 hours or overnight. This helps soften the chickpeas and reduce their cooking time.

Can I skip the soaking step and cook dried chickpeas directly?

While it is possible to cook dried chickpeas without soaking, it will significantly increase the cooking time. Soaking helps hydrate the chickpeas and ensures they cook more evenly.

How long does it take to cook soaked dried chickpeas?

Cooking times can vary, but generally, soaked chickpeas take about 1 to 1.5 hours to cook on the stovetop. It may take longer if the chickpeas are older or not soaked adequately.

Can I use a pressure cooker to cook dried chickpeas?

Yes, using a pressure cooker can significantly reduce the cooking time for dried chickpeas. It typically takes around 20-25 minutes under pressure to cook soaked chickpeas.

Should I add salt while cooking dried chickpeas?

It is recommended to add salt towards the end of the cooking process or after the chickpeas are fully cooked. Adding salt at the beginning can toughen the chickpeas and prolong the cooking time.

How do I know when dried chickpeas are cooked and ready to eat?

The chickpeas are cooked when they are tender and can be easily mashed between your fingers. Taste a few chickpeas to ensure they are cooked to your desired tenderness.

Can I use canned chickpeas instead of cooking dried chickpeas?

Yes, canned chickpeas are a convenient alternative to cooking dried chickpeas. They are pre-cooked and ready to use in various recipes. Just make sure to rinse them thoroughly before using to reduce sodium content.

Are there any health benefits to eating cooked chickpeas?

Yes, chickpeas are rich in fiber, protein, and various vitamins and minerals. They can contribute to a healthy digestive system, help manage blood sugar levels, and support heart health, among other benefits.
